For DEER, protein samples are flash-frozen, So freezing each receptor molecule in a specific conformation, and investigated by electron paramagnetic resonance spectroscopy at fifty K. The measurable distances within the ensemble are preferably in the 2–5 nm range. The DEER details from the µOR, labelled at positions 182 for the intracellular finish in proleviate helps block pain receptors the transmembrane helix (TM) 4 and 276 on TM6, could be spelled out most effective by a sum of six distances. Four of those ended up considered to become fascinating, since they improved upon agonist application and could be matched to significant-resolution structures (Fig. one). Each and every of such distances signifies not less than 1 putative conformation of your µOR. Dependant on our understanding of GPCR activation, The 2 shorter distances were assigned to inactive conformations While the for a longer period ones were being assigned to Lively conformations. Partial agonists experienced small impact on the basal conformational distribution, and even the total agonist DAMGO compelled only a small proportion of your receptor into active conformations. This getting is reminiscent of the 1st crystal structures of agonist-bound β2-adrenergic receptors, which resembled inactive receptors to the intracellular side3 Unless of course G-protein or G-protein-mimicking nanobodies were present.
